Satire Podcast by Victoria Madison and Olivia
Victoria Ludwig
Overview
Episodes
Details
Satire in Huck Finn
Recent Episodes
MAR 1, 2018
Feb 28, 2018
Satire podcast
7 MIN
See all episodes